
Vans is introducing a sneaker that will be set to release next year. The sneaker shown above is a new version of Vans Sk8 Hi which is product of Vans’ collaboration with a Tokyo based fashion brand, Deluxe.
This collaboration has resulted to a very unique piece of footwear using a stamped leather and simple colors. The upper of this Sk8 Hi is made from leather with a wood grain like stamps. This leather even looks like a real wood because of the texture that it gives. This is also made with perforations on the toe box to make it comfortable to wear. It also has a printed insole lining to contrast the black upper. This footwear also has a white rubber outsole with a stripe of red around it for accent.
This Sk8 Hi sneaker from Vans will be released on May 2009 but other online stores are now welcoming pre orders for as much as $150.00.
